Produktbeschreibung:

Der Festool T 18+3 Akku Bohrschrauber ist für an Maximum an Flexibilität konzipiert worden. Die vollelektronische Drehmomenteinstellung, der Winkel- und Exzentervorsatz ( nicht im Lieferumfang ), das CENTROTEC Schnellwechselsystem sowie der Tiefenschlag sind die Lösung bei jeder Bohr- oder Schraubanwendung. Für die Langlebigkeit sorgen der bürstenlose EC-TEC Motor, sowie die Kombination aus den Li-High Power Akkus ( nicht im Lieferumfang ). Das leichte Gewicht und das ausdauernde Arbeitsverhalten zeichnen ihn aus. Weitere Raffinessen sind das Umschalten von Schrauben auf Bohren ohne eine Drehmomentverstellung und die FastFix Schnittstelle die ein sekundenschnellen Wechsel der Vorsätze gewährleistet. Dank der kompakten Bauform und dem geringen Gewicht ist er ein Meister in sämtlichen Montagebereichen. Ob Türen, Rückwände, Leisten oder ganze Küchen der Festool T 18+3 Basic Akku Bohrschrauber lässt einen nicht im Stich. Festool steht für höchste Qualitätsansprüche und sehr gut durchdachte Werkzeugkonzepte, der T 18+3 bestätigt dies.

Technische Daten:

Hersteller: Festool
Herstellerbezeichnung: T 18+3-Basic
Herstellernnummer: 576448
Akkuspannung: 18 V
Gänge: 2
Leerlaufdrehzahl 1./2. Gang: 0 - 450/0 - 1500 min⁻¹
Bohrdurchmesser Holz/Stahl: 45/13 mm
Drehmomenteinstellung 1./2. Gang: 0,8 - 8/0,5 - 6 Nm
Max. Drehmoment Holz/Stahl: 35/50 Nm
Bohrfutterspannweite: 1,5 - 13 mm
Bohren in Metall: Normenreihe EN 60745: 62841
Bohren in Metall: Unsicherheit (Lärm) K: 5 dB
Bohren in Metall: Unsicherheit (Vibration) K: 1,50 m/s²
Bohren in Metall: A-bewerteter Schalldruckpegel Lp: 64 dB(A)
Bohren in Metall: A-bewerteter Schallleistungspegel Lw: 75 dB(A)
Bohren in Metall: Gesamt-Schwingungsmittelwert ah: 2,70 m/s²
Schrauben: Gesamt-Schwingungsmittelwert ah: 2,50 m/s²
Schrauben: Normenreihe EN 60745: 62841
Schrauben: Unsicherheit (Lärm) K: 5dB
Schrauben: Unsicherheit (Vibration) K: 1,50 m/s²
Schrauben: A-bewerteter Schalldruckpegel Lp: 64 dB(A)
Schrauben: A-bewerteter Schallleistungspegel Lw: 75 dB(A)
